公司软件涉及多个用户终端,研发内部测试或者工程出差经常会涉及到主机IP地址修改的问题,每次修改IP地址都需要打开网络和共享中心,更改适配器设置,修改对应网络连接的IP属性。使用脚本实现省时又省力。步骤如下:
一,新建一个文本文档,在记事本中粘贴以下代码:
1、静态IP脚本:
netsh interface ip set address name="本地连接" source=static addr=192.168.1.133 mask=255.255.255.0 gateway=192.168.1.1
netsh interface ip set dns name="本地连接" source=static addr=192.168.1.1 validate=no
说明:
第一条语句中,set address是设置IP地址。
name=“本地连接”,指用哪个连接上网,依网络适配情况填写。
source=static,指设置的静态IP
addr指设置的IP地址
gateway指默认网关
第2条语句中,set dns是设置DNS服务器地址。
addr指首选DNS服务器
2、动态IP脚本:
netsh interface ip set address name="本地连接" source=dhcp
netsh interface ip set dns name="本地连接" source=dhcp
说明:此设置为自动获取IP
二:另存为.bat
文档另存为,保存类型选择“所有文件”,文件名以.bat结尾,编码方式为ANSI。
保存后文件显示如下:
三、以管理员身份运行。
选中保存后的文件,右键。
点击“以管理员身份运行”
运行时会弹出Windows应用程序提示框:
若提示“配置的DNS服务器不正确或不存在”,则在dns设置语句后加一个 validate=no(验证是否有效)
运行后查看网络属性:
四、若修改,则右键文件,选择“编辑”,修改后保存再运行。